What Does a New Detached ADU Cost and Involve in West Park?

A new detached ADU in West Park typically runs $90,000-$220,000 and takes 4-7 months from permit to final inspection, depending on whether you choose prefab delivery or stick-built construction. Most homeowners in the 33023 zip add 400-800 square feet behind their existing home, often replacing an aging garage or filling in a narrow backyard that floods during summer storms. How We Build a New Detached ADU in West Park

We’ve learned that the sequence matters more than the sales pitch. Here’s how a typical new detached ADU moves through our hands, and what you’ll need to decide at each point.

Stage 1: Site survey and permit archaeology (2-3 weeks)

We start with a boundary survey and a trip to West Park’s building department. Because this city only incorporated in 2005, we routinely find county-era work on your property that was never properly finaled. We’ll pull every record available, flag anything that needs remediation, and only then file your new ADU permit. You decide at this stage: do we handle the retroactive corrections as part of our scope, or do you want to separate that work?

Stage 2: Foundation and drainage (3-4 weeks)

West Park’s flat terrain and high water table mean we almost always need to raise the ADU pad or install a stem-wall foundation with integrated drainage. We bring in a soils report if your lot sits in a pocket that ponds after heavy rain. You’ll choose your floor height relative to the main house and whether to tie into your existing stormwater system or create a separate French drain.

Stage 3: Shell construction or prefab delivery (6-10 weeks)

For stick-built, we frame, sheath, and roof on site. For prefab, we coordinate crane access and set a unit from one of our partners. This is where your material choices lock in: siding, roofing, window package, and exterior door grade. You’ll also decide on your electrical service path, most older homes in 33023 need a panel upgrade from 60-100 amp to 200 amp to handle the ADU load.

Stage 4: MEP rough-in and insulation (2-3 weeks)

Plumbing, electrical, and HVAC get roughed in. We spec mini-splits for cooling since extending central ductwork to a detached structure rarely makes sense in South Florida’s humidity. Your decisions here: tankless vs. standard water heater, smart thermostat compatibility, and whether to pre-wire for EV charging or solar tie-in later.

Stage 5: Interior finish and final inspection (3-4 weeks)

Drywall, flooring, cabinetry, fixtures, and paint. We schedule West Park’s final inspection only after passing our own punch list. You’ll do a walkthrough with our project lead and sign off before we hand over keys.

The Build Paths You’ll Choose Between

Every new detached ADU forces real trade-offs. We don’t pretend one path fits everyone.

  • Prefab delivery (Abodu, Dvele, Mighty Buildings, Boxabl, Plant Prefab): Faster, often 30-50% shorter build time. Factory-controlled quality. But you’re limited to their dimensional modules, and crane access in tight 33023 lots can add $3,000-$8,000. Best for homeowners who want a finished product fast and don’t need custom footprints.
  • Stick-built on site: Full freedom on layout, ceiling heights, and roofline matching your main house. Takes longer, more weather exposure, more decisions to manage. Best when your lot has odd geometry or you want the ADU to read as original construction.
  • Foundation type: Slab-on-grade is cheapest but risky in West Park’s saturated soils. Stem wall or raised pile foundation adds $8,000-$18,000 but prevents the moisture intrusion we see destroy finished floors in low-lying 33023 properties.
  • Kitchen and bath fixtures: Kohler and Moen lines give you tiered pricing without sacrificing parts availability. We stock both because South Florida’s mineral-heavy water chews through cheap cartridges in two years.
  • Countertop surfaces: Silestone and Caesarstone both handle humidity well. Silestone runs slightly higher but offers more textured finishes; Caesarstone’s standard polish works fine for rental ADUs where durability beats aesthetics.

What New Detached ADU Costs in West Park, FL

Component Typical Range
Base ADU construction (400-800 sq ft) $90,000-$220,000
Foundation upgrade (raised/stem wall) $8,000-$18,000
Electrical panel upgrade to 200 amp $3,500-$7,500
Site drainage / stormwater compliance $4,000-$12,000
Permit retroactive corrections (if needed) $2,500-$15,000

Five factors push you toward the high or low end of that $90,000-$220,000 range. Size is obvious: every additional 100 square feet adds roughly $15,000-$25,000 in this market. Existing conditions matter more in West Park than most cities, that unpermitted garage conversion from 1987 could cost $10,000 to bring current before we pour new footings. Relocating plumbing or electrical from the main house adds trenching, backflow prevention, and often a new sewer tap fee. Material grade separates a rental-grade ADU from a mother-in-law suite with custom cabinetry and impact-rated windows. Finally, permit scope: a simple backyard structure moves faster than anything requiring variance or HOA architectural review in the city’s older subdivisions.

Our written estimates include all labor, materials, permits, and inspections. They do not include your survey, soil testing if required, or utility connection fees charged directly by the city or county. We flag those separately so you’re not surprised.

Why West Park Homes Make This Job Different

West Park’s history as unincorporated Broward County until 2005 creates a permitting environment unlike neighboring Hollywood or Miramar. When we file for a new detached ADU here, the building department’s first move is often to cross-check your property against county records from the 1960s through 2004. We’ve found carports enclosed without permits, second electrical panels added by handymen, and room additions that were never structurally tied to the original CBS walls. Each of these triggers a stop-work hold until we engineer a fix and get it signed off.

The housing stock itself compounds this. Those 1950s-1970s concrete block homes on original slabs were built for a different Florida Building Code. Their roofs weren’t designed for the wind loads we calculate now, and their electrical systems can’t handle a modern ADU without significant upstream work. Add the near-surface water table that turns any foundation excavation into a dewatering challenge, and you’ve got a project where “simple backyard cottage” rarely stays simple. We’ve learned to price and schedule for these realities upfront rather than discover them mid-trench.
